Check Digit Verification of cas no
The CAS Registry Mumber 113277-55-7 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,1,3,2,7 and 7 respectively; the second part has 2 digits, 5 and 5 respectively.
Calculate Digit Verification of CAS Registry Number 113277-55:
(8*1)+(7*1)+(6*3)+(5*2)+(4*7)+(3*7)+(2*5)+(1*5)=107
107 % 10 = 7
So 113277-55-7 is a valid CAS Registry Number.
